TED BERRY CO., INC. v. EXCELSIOR INS. CO.

Civil No. 2:13-CV-342-DBH.

997 F.Supp.2d 66 (2014)

TED BERRY COMPANY, INC., Plaintiff, v. EXCELSIOR INSURANCE COMPANY, Defendant.

United States District Court, D. Maine.

February 4, 2014.

DECISION AND ORDER ON CROSS-MOTIONS FOR SUMMARY JUDGMENT

D. BROCK HORNBY, District Judge.

This is a dispute about an insurance company's duty to defend its insured for property damages under a commercial general liability (CGL) policy and exclusions associated with such a policy. On the duty to defend (Counts I and II), the record is stipulated. It consists of the applicable CGL policy and a New Hampshire complaint against the insured for breach of contract...
